Purpose of Fire Alarm Testing Tools
This type of equipment simulates real fire conditions using authentic triggers such as heat, aerosol particles, or manual activation signals. It ensures the system responds identically in a genuine emergency. This controlled testing method improves both reliability and accuracy.
It allows users to:
- Confirm smoke detectors respond to particles
- Test heat detectors trigger with heat
- Check sounders and beacons operate correctly
- Support scheduled maintenance and regulatory checks
- Detect faults early for preventive repair
This is especially important for environments such as commercial properties, public sector facilities, manufacturing areas, and housing developments.
Different Kinds of Fire Alarm Test Tools
Several equipment types serve distinct functions:
Smoke Detector Testers
These release a safe aerosol that mimics smoke particles, prompting the detector to respond. Ideal for most standard applications, including commercial premises, corridors, and domestic settings.
Heat Detector Testers
These tools apply measured heat to verify response. Particularly useful in environments like kitchens, factories, and mechanical areas where smoke testing would be inappropriate.
Integrated Smoke and Heat Test Kits
These kits combine smoke and heat testing in one solution, often with telescopic arms to reach high ceilings safely, minimising risk during routine checks.
Sound Level and System Testers
These measure whether alarms reach sufficient decibel levels, confirming that occupants will hear them during evacuations.
Why Regular Testing is Essential
Routine testing goes beyond good practice. It is a legal obligation, protects lives, and reduces the risk of system failure. Consistent testing helps to:
- Ensure detectors activate when required
- Confirm system response meets timing expectations
- Demonstrate compliance with fire safety regulations
- Maintain accurate maintenance records for accountability
Effective alarms lead to quicker warnings, supporting faster evacuation and reducing potential damage.
Choosing the Right Testing Equipment
Selection depends on several factors:
- Detector types installed
- Ceiling height and access needs
- Test frequency
- Who carries out testing
- Use case, such as commercial
High-grade testing tools make inspections quicker and safer. Many modern units are portable, simple to operate, and built for convenience, promoting consistency in maintenance routines.
